QFBA launches 2014 course calendar
The Qatar Finance and Business Academy (QFBA) has launched its 2014 course calendar that includes banking, insurance, finance, Islamic finance, capital markets and asset management, compliance and anti-money laundering, business management, as well as training for soft and foundation skills. QFBA CEO Dr Abdulaziz al-Horr said: “The year 2014 is crucial for QFBA’s development and will see the implementation of a series of intelligently designed courses, as well as advanced registration and deployment techniques to help make the process much easier for participants.” The QFBA is a certified training provider that is recognised by local authorities. It issues many specialised international certificates in partnership with recognised partners. Dr al-Horr said: “The broader focus, in addition to the scheduled calendar, is to help organisations, including financial services providers in Qatar and businesses of all sizes, identify their organisational training requirements and tailor solutions for their staff.”He said the QFBA’s experienced training staff are already working with many large organisations.“We believe in delivering quality education, so every course is tailored to have a relatively small educator to trainee ratio, which allows for more interactive classes and gives every registrant a better learning experience,” he said.The QFBA has over 1000sqm space designed to accommodate simultaneous courses in different classrooms. The nine classrooms can accommodate up to 100 participants. The facility which is situated in QFC Tower 2 is one of the most advanced of its kind in Qatar and is supported by specialised staff with international training experience. In addition, course durations are tailored to meet professional schedules that vary from three days to 10 days, plus more intensive courses such as CPA, CFA and CMA certification, which can be delivered in around 35 days. The QFBA was established to fulfil the need for a specialised training provider capable of helping Qatari institutions grow their potential and embrace modern finance and business principles as they grow and contribute towards helping Qatar become a truly sustainable market economy driven by knowledge-based solutions and global best practices.
